Fitzgerald’s Irish Bed & Breakfast offers warm Irish hospitality
in a unique sixteen-room French Tudor built in 1937.
This magnificent and recently restored home is a
landmark of craftsmanship, from its ornate
staircase, hard-wood floors throughout,
unusual turret and slate roof, to its elaborate 11
foot fireplace. You will be charmed by its unique
castle-like architecture.
Just three miles away are some of the most-visited
trails and beaches in the Great Lakes region. Mentor
Headlands and Fairport Harbor are the two most
popular Lake Erie beaches. Also close by are over twenty
of Ohio's finest
wineries, Holden Arboretum, Kirtland Mormon
Temple, Lawnfield and abundant shopping in Mentor.
Several restaurants are
within walking distance offering family style
dining, fast food, or gourmet dining.
Fitzgerald’s Irish Bed & Breakfast is located 30
minutes east of downtown Cleveland, close enough to take in a
Browns, Indians, Cavaliers or Force game. Also in
Cleveland is the Rock-n-Roll Hall of Fame, the
theatre district, Severance Hall, Cleveland Metro
Parks Zoo, and the Cleveland Museum of Art.
